Yotto delivers deep masterclass on Faithless ‘I Need Someone’

Acclaimed Finnish deep house Producer and DJ Yotto presents an unforgettably stirring, yet driving, remix of Faithless fan favourite ‘I Need Someone’, released on BMG on 12 March.

With his remix, Yotto showcases his experimental side with a brooding, highly atmospheric update which evokes fond memories of dimly lit dancefloors well into the early hours.

On Yotto’s remix of ‘I Need SomeoneFaithless said:

Yotto delivers a masterclass in deep, brooding hypnotic grooves. Nestling in a bed of swelling analogue pads and fluttering electronic flourishes. What a joy! Nathan Ball’s vocal shines with almost religious intensity. With a massive string-led breakdown, to us this remix feels like a sun coming up moment…and then some!

I Need Someone’ is the second single to be taken from Faithless ‘All Blessed’, their first studio LP in 10 years, out now on BMG and winning rave reviews from press and fans alike. Featuring in several Best Albums Of 2020 lists, ‘All Blessed’ charted at No.6 in the Official Album Chart and No.1 in the Dance Album Chart and No.1 in the Independent Album Chart.

KAS:ST Release Stunning New Music Video for ‘Hold Me To The Light’

KAS:ST
Kas:st

Fresh off the back of their A Magic World album, vital dance duo KAS:ST is back with a third stunning new music video. ‘Hold Me To The Light’ lands exactly one year after the music industry ground to a halt due to the Covid-19 pandemic, and is a timely reminder of how sorely missed that sense of dance floor unity really is.

This new video from the French duo and Flyance Records owners – written and directed by Urban Film Festival Award 2019 winners Kevin Gay and Henri Coutant – is an ode to the hedonists and nightlife lovers, nocturnal party people and the diverse mix of dancers who make up the underground music scene.

It takes you to the heart of various parties with fantastically styled and dressed-up characters, mesmeric light shows and cascades of confetti that all drop you right to the middle of a party at the peak of the night.

The track it accompanies was one of the biggest melodic tunes of 2019 and 2020, and it comes on the heels of ‘VTOPIA‘, which landed in November and, along with the first in the series, has already amassed a total of more than six million views.

KAS:ST make music with dramatic breakdowns and big melodic highs. They bring the emotional elements of trance and their own grandiose grooves to labels like Afterlife, and amplify each tune with rich production, as showcased in this new video once more.

This is another wonderful window into the world of KAS:ST and a momentary escape back to better times.

UNUM Festival finalises headliners for 2021 edition

UNUM Festival

Europe’s most exciting new underground event just got even better as UNUM Festival 2021 adds a pair of standout headliners in Sven Väth and Ben Klock, plus Mathew Jonson, Dana Ruh, Tobi Neumann and more global greats.

On top of this come 15 talented and local stars who are quickly on the rise, and forward-thinking partnerships with iconic brands like Sunwaves, Modernity, Club Der Visionaere, Nordsten, and sCs, plus a guarantee from the Albanian Ministries of Tourism, Environment, and Health that the event will go ahead this year from June 3rd – 7th.

UNUM has already cemented itself amongst the European elite for a number of reasons – the close-knit first edition was a memorable gathering of real music lovers in an upcoming region of the world. The festival really shined a spotlight on Rana e Hedhun, the last untapped corner of Europe in the town of Shengjin, on the idyllic Albanian coastline. It is a rare natural, organic and uncommercialised setting that allows for non stop music night and day, plus sunrise and sunset parties, beach parties, water sports, plenty of local culture, food and drink offerings as well as isolated bays and gold sand beaches to explore.

This year the bar will be raised again with the news that world class clubs and promotions will line up as partners. Each of these collectives will bring their own special know how and sense of underground style to UNUM and include cult Romanian techno festival Sunwaves, the unique party in the Alps that is Modernity, Berlin’s underground haven Club Der Visionaere plus the River Rhine‘s floating nightclub Nordsten and more.

Now also playing across the five days of enchanting and escapist hedonism will be techno pioneers like Cocoon‘s Sven Vath and Berghain‘s own Ben Klock, plus the always essential master of his machines that is Mathew Jonson plus deep house’s finest Dana Ruh, Cocoon‘s long time tastemaker Tobi Neumann as well as Manu Gonzalez, Jamie Roy, Andy Luff, Colin Chiddle and over 15 local artists who bring their own distinctive house and techno flavours and perspectives.

Already announced are the likes of Ricardo Villalobos, Priku, Praslea, tINI, Sonja Moonear, Shaun Reeves, Raresh, Cesar Merveille, Dyed Soundorom, Leon and more.

Ferry Corsten provides hope with heady new single ‘High On You’ (ft. Maria Marcus)

Ferry Corsten

Ferry Corsten has committed extended periods recently creatively exploring new ways to tie his wide breadth of musical influences into his music. His first single of 2021, ‘High On You’, features the vocal talent of Maria Marcus, is a true testament to the development of his artistry.

Last year saw various projects, including his ambient album ‘As Above So Below‘ under the FERR alias and the breakbeat-fuelled ‘Black Lion‘ with Ejeca’s Trance Wax alias and most recently the melodic techno-leaning ‘I Don’t Need You‘. Ferry‘s latest offering is a breaky, garage-tinged number that represents a perfect balance of the sounds that inspire him, as he continues to break new ground and demonstrate why he’s been able to stay ahead of the curve throughout his long and distinguished career.

Ferry hits the sweet spot with ‘High On You‘, combining the electronic sensibilities underpinning all his music with his love of atmospheric cinematics. Of which is highlighted by the exquisite strings and piano accompaniments that see Ferry delving deeper into his musicality to provide the perfect soundbed for Maria Marcus‘ vocals to shine through.

On ‘High On You‘, Ferry said: “I’m very excited about this release because it is way out of my comfort zone. I’ve always been a big fan of the mid 90’s UK breaks sound. Combining that with the beauty of orchestral instruments is a very fresh take on music for me. It was an absolute pleasure to work with Maria on this song. The way she builds the track towards the end with all the various harmonies and layers is just incredible.

Maximising all this extra time in the studio, Ferry has taken new approaches to his music and used it to explore different sound structures. With his latest single, the hopeful ‘High On You‘, Ferry has crafted a track that strikes the perfect balance between songwriting and rhythm. Lending itself to a broader diversity in sound that it is just as likely to be heard on the radio as it is in DJ sets over the coming months.

2021 looks set to see more innovative and refreshing new music from an artist that continues to carve out his niche in the electronic music space.

Joe Goddard and Franky Rizardo reveal brand new ollaboration ‘No Judgement’

Franky Rizardo

In a plan to bring artists together during these last unconventional 12 months, BBC Radio 1’s Danny Howard launched the ‘Lockdown Link Up’ on his Friday night show.

Pairing up artists & producers at random, Franky Rizardo and Joe Goddard were two out of sixteen dually selected to collaborate on a production during their time in isolation. Now, as the track has progressed it is being officially released on the renowned FFRR as ‘No Judgement‘, out today.

As two of electronic music’s most current & established artists, Franky Rizardo and Joe Goddard deliver a melodic electronic ballad with a crunchy bass that progresses beautifully around a strong and emotive vocal.

Long established as an international touring artist as well as a name firmly engrained within his own country, promoted his LTF brand across global festivals such as Tomorrowland and had individual appearances at ANTS, elrow and more. Consistently aiming to do his own thing Franky has hosted shows on both Amsterdam’s SLAM! Radio station and London’s Rinse FM. His name is synonymous with deep driving house that blurs the lines between tech and house, releasing on labels such as Strictly Rhythm, Saved and 8Bit.

A member of the highly acclaimed Hot Chip & The 2 Bears, Joe Goddard is a songwriter, producer, DJ, remixer & co-founder of his own Greco-Roman label. With a thirst for experimentation, an instinctive understanding of the dancefloor and love of left of centre pop music his production response is dynamic. He has remixed the likes of Kraftwerk, New Order, Disclosure, Dirty Projectors and The Chemical Brothers, Wiley and Jessie Ware as well as produced for Franz Ferdinand and Bernard Summer.

A keen collaborator Joe Goddard has released tracks with Michael Mayer, Tuff City Kids, Eats Everything, Matthew Dear and he now teams with one of electronic music’s most compelling individuals, as they set themselves up to reveal ‘No Judgement‘ to the rest of the world.

Carl Cox drops stunning remix of BreakCode’s ‘What Lies Beneath’

Carl Cox

After an eventful year in unprecedented times, the undisputed king of techno Carl Cox is back with an outstanding remix of the rising London-based electronic live act BreakCode’s ‘What Lies Beneath’ on 26th February2021.

Described as a ‘full assault on your musical senses’, the original was first released late 2019 and blended pounding techno drums with breaks, eerie eastern promise sounds and a mental acid line. As if the track wasn’t already hot enough, Carl has added even more fuel to the fire by cranking up the tempo, adding extra layers of percussion and synth alongside a wealth of bass frequencies to deliver one of his best remixes to date.

Carl‘s been a solid supporter of BreakCode‘s music since its inception and says: “BreakCode is making some seriously mental music, creating it more like a band would instead of a DJ. I supported it all last year since its inception and it was amazing to put my own take on such a great idea for a different track that seriously stands out amongst the rest.

Aside from Carl, the track has also garnered support from other leading DJs such as Eats Everything, Enrico Sanguillano, Tiesto and Hardwell amongst others.

Julian Jordan and Guy Arthur team up on summer-ready new track ‘Let Me Be The One’

Julian Jordan
Julian Jordan

After claiming the first spot on Beatport’s Top Electro House Chart last year and kicking off 2021 with the sharp and aggressive basslines of ‘Big Bad Bass’, Julian Jordan is finally back with a radio-friendly gem in collaboration with fellow STMPD producer Guy Arthur.

Spinning synths and grave melancholy piano chords combined with an echoing topline start off the track, which is soon joined by upbeat chiming beats and propelled into a palpitating bridge.

Rubbery bass throbs underline the pitched and distorted vocals of the drop making for an even more thumping beat and contrast with the softer verse that follows. A final acceleration elevates into the final drop to end the song on a boisterous note.

Guy Arthur remixed Julian Jordan‘s ‘Love You Better’ last year and the two decided to now fully collaborate to bring the world the enticing and fiery ‘Let Me Be The One‘.

Nicole Moudaber enlists club icon Alan T for new EP ‘The Volume’

Nicole Moudaber

With the world’s live music scene at a seemingly-continuous standstill, one of electronic music’s most iconic figures, Nicole Moudaber, has been hard at work behind closed doors in her pursuit to keep the industry’s spirits alive and thriving.

Enlisting the help of legendary door picker and dear friend Alan T, Nicole delivers her brand new EP The Volume. Representing some of her most liberally untethered work to date, the 2-track opus echoes a tenacious dedication to both her craft and the circuit in which its home to – The Volume EP is out now on her own MOOD Records.

Opening with The Volume, Nicole lays a foundation of groove-induced percussive elements, reflective of her mastery for House music. Alan T’s seductive vocal offering enters the space, transcending the listener to the dark, smoky dancefloors the cut so desperately craves. Above a continuous airy soundscape, the track journeys through intoxicating highs and reflective breaks, evoking a notion of deep nostalgia and yearning.

It is this harmonious contrast of sharp percussion and melodic bliss that establishes such hypnotic fluidity and makes this one of the most exciting additions to Nicole’s extensive discography, which now only grows to hold more future classics.

With our eyes already closed in rapture, the EP’s B-side The Music Is Mine begins, presenting a gritty pulsating kick with incentivising off-beat licks. Alan T and Nicole’s vocal chopped trills and stabs make their entrance, oscillating in volume and intensity with a delirious flair that permeates the senses. Although decorated with intricate sound design elements, the track’s core motive is raw and relatable, conducive to euphoric club experiences and free expression.

Alan T stands as a key ambassador for Miami’s underground scene following his many years of service to its distinguished venue, Club Space. The duo met during Winter Music Conference in the early 2000’s and found themselves reconvening on the dance floor ever since.

“Alan IS Miami, basically,” Moudaber exclaims, “people would go to Club Space just to see him.” Profoundly knowledgeable in all things club culture, the former architect is a visual artist, larger than life cultural icon, progressive fashion guru and everything in between. Having already dabbled in production back in 1996 when he lent his persona and voice to Circuit’s Boy’s dance anthem ‘The Door’, his contribution to Moudaber’s ‘The Volume’ is a much coveted resurgence for Tibaldeo, whose multifaceted talents know no bounds.

Restless in her forward momentum and pursuit of new sounds, Nicole Moudaber has ensured her relevancy in a fast-changing techno landscape and continues to lead the circuit into new territories with her unique perspective on the genre. Facilitating such a lucrative collaboration between two of the scene’s most compelling characters from either side of the booth, Nicole has once again provided us with a level of artistry that goes above and beyond that of her peers.

Having just released a dedicated International Women’s Day episode of In The MOOD Radio, which features remixes from Sevdaliza, Rosalía, TSHA, Logic1000, Lauren Flaz, ANZ and Peaches, Nicole now looks ahead to her award-winning radio show’s 7th Anniversary, which will be celebrated with a special livestream.
